What Are Municipal By-Laws?
Municipal by-laws in South Africa are regulations created by local authorities to govern specific matters within their jurisdiction. These laws cover various aspects of everyday life, from zoning and building regulations to health and safety requirements. Understanding these by-laws is crucial for residents, businesses, and developers to ensure compliance and avoid legal issues.

Types of Municipal By-Laws
South Africa's municipal by-laws can vary widely depending on the local authority. However, they generally fall into several categories:
- Health and Safety By-Laws: These regulate hygiene standards in food establishments, public health regulations, and waste management.
- Building By-Laws: These govern construction practices, building design, and property maintenance.
- Zoning By-Laws: They dictate land use and ensure that different types of developments align with community needs.
- Environmental By-Laws: These protect natural resources and regulate activities that may have environmental impacts.
